What Immigration Habeas Corpus Actually Involves
Put simply, a habeas corpus petition is a federal-level challenge filed in federal district court claiming that the government is holding someone without lawful authority. In the immigration context, this typically arises when a detainee has been confined for far too long without a real possibility of being released, or when the legal basis for their detention has become questionable under Supreme Court precedent.
Preparing such a filing is nothing like submitting a standard immigration form. It requires drafting legal arguments under 28 U.S.C. § 2241, establishing federal court jurisdiction, naming the proper respondents, and framing constitutional claims with precision. The court expects petitioners to back up their petitions with detention records, timelines, sworn declarations, and legal memoranda that respond to government arguments. For someone locked inside a detention facility — often without web connectivity, legal research materials, or even reliable phone calls — navigating this process alone is extremely difficult.
Why Small Errors Can Have Enormous Consequences
Federal courts are procedurally demanding. A petition that names the wrong custodian, files in the wrong district, or fails to properly exhaust available remedies can be denied before a judge ever reviews the substance. When that happens, critical weeks or months are lost while the detainee remains in custody.
An experienced immigration attorney grasps how to structure a habeas petition so that it overcomes these first-stage challenges. They know which legal theories apply to each type of detention — regardless of whether the client is held under mandatory detention provisions, is subject to a final order of removal, or falls into one of the categories addressed by landmark rulings like Zadvydas v. Davis, which caps post-order detention to a reasonable period. Applying the right framework to the right facts is what turns a failed petition into a favorable one.

Texas plays a particular role in the national immigration landscape. The state hosts numerous ICE detention facilities, and detainees in Galveston Island, TX often confront an enforcement climate that has been particularly aggressive. Cases arising in this region generally belong to the jurisdiction of federal courts within the Fifth Circuit Court of Appeals, which has developed its own body of habeas case law that practitioners must be deeply familiar with.

Who is eligible to file a petition for Immigration Habeas Corpus in Galveston Island, TX?
Eligibility to file for Immigration Habeas Corpus generally requires that the individual is currently in the custody of immigration authorities, that their detention may be unlawful or unreasonably prolonged, and that other administrative remedies have been exhausted or are unavailable. Typical bases include prolonged or indefinite custody, being held without an opportunity for a bond hearing, or detention that infringes on due process rights. What paperwork is needed to file an Immigration Habeas Corpus petition?
Petitioners usually are required to present a written habeas corpus petition explaining the legal and factual grounds, verification of current immigration custody, documentation from past immigration proceedings, identity records, any prior bond or custody decisions, evidence of medical or humanitarian matters, and supporting affidavits or declarations tied to the case. Can I be released from detention while my Immigration Habeas Corpus petition is pending?
On occasion, a federal judge might order a bond hearing, allow release with specific conditions, or require the government to demonstrate why continued detention is necessary while the petition is under consideration. Whether release is granted hinges on the particular legal points made and the individual facts of the matter. What happens if my Immigration Habeas Corpus petition is denied?
If a habeas corpus petition is denied, the court will issue a ruling explaining its reasoning. Based on the situation, available options can include appealing to the federal circuit court, filing a motion asking the court to reconsider, or exploring other immigration remedies.
